We’ve been tenants in this chawl for over 60 years. There’s a dispute with our landlord and the neighboring building over encroached land, ongoing since 2011. The BMC has demolished the adjacent building 5-7 times, each time sending debris crashing onto our roofs, severely damaging our home. Despite repeated complaints, they continue this destructive approach, seemingly at the landlord’s behest to force us out. We urgently need help as the BMC is likely to demolish the building again.
Best Answer
Under Indian law, you have the right to peaceful enjoyment of your tenancy. The BMC’s actions, causing repeated damage and potentially endangering your home, violate this right. You can approach the court for an injunction restraining the demolition and seek compensation for damages.
